While I was reading your post above I was listening to the radio - some twerp called Ryan Tubridy who annoys me no end because he just talks absolute crap. Anyway he hosts a television show and his guest is going to be Dolly Parton in the next few weeks. He was discussing the point you mentioned above about Tom Parker wanting 50% of the rights to the song. And Dolly was right to refuse him. I wonder how much she has earned in royalties from that one song. A lot of people think Dolly is this dumb blonde type but she has a shrewd business brain and is seldom outsmarted. One clever cookie indeed.
Dolly's reply to a reporter who asked her why she always looked so cheap.
'Honey, it takes an awful lot of money to look this cheap' 10/10!!!
